Sokolow v. Palestine Liberation Org.
2d Circuit, No. 15-3135(L), 15-3151(XAP), 22-1060(CON) (filed Nov. 3, 2022)
Nov. 3, 2022Brief of the American Association for Justice as Amicus Curiae in Support of Plaintiff-Appellants and Reversal
Issue: Whether, pursuant to the personal jurisdiction provisions of the Anti-Terrorist Act (“ATA”), Congress has the authority to prescribe the manner in which foreign entities can indicate their consent to appear in American courts in response to ATA claims brought by Americans seeking legal redress for wrongful deaths and injuries caused by terrorist attacks planned or carried out by employees or agents of those foreign entities.
Full Citation: Brief for American Association for Justice as Amicus Curiae in Support of Plaintiff-Appellants and Reversal, Sokolow v. Palestine Liberation Org., No. 15-3135(L) (2d Cir. Nov. 3, 2022)
